Overview
The industrial waterproof socket box is an essential component for safe electrical distribution in challenging environments. These specialized enclosures provide protected power access where standard electrical boxes would fail due to moisture, dust, or physical impacts. Designed to meet stringent international protection standards, modern waterproof socket boxes combine durable materials with precision engineering to maintain electrical safety in the most demanding conditions. They serve as critical infrastructure in industries ranging from construction and mining to food processing and marine operations.
Structure and Working Principle
A typical industrial waterproof socket box consists of a robust outer housing, internal mounting plate, gasket-sealed lid, and modular socket arrangement. The housing forms the primary barrier against environmental factors, while the lid incorporates compression gaskets that create a watertight seal when closed. Internally, the socket mounting plate provides secure electrical connections with proper isolation between circuits. High-quality models feature gland entries for cable management and may include additional protective devices like circuit breakers or RCDs. The working principle relies on maintaining complete environmental separation between the electrical components and external conditions through multiple sealing barriers.
Key Features
Industrial-grade waterproof socket boxes distinguish themselves through several critical features. Most importantly, they achieve IP65 or higher protection ratings, meaning they're dust-tight and protected against water jets from any direction. Premium models often include corrosion-resistant stainless steel hardware, transparent viewing windows for quick status checks, and innovative lid designs that prevent water pooling. Many feature modular construction allowing customizable socket combinations (e.g., 16A/32A, single/three-phase) to suit specific application needs. Some advanced versions incorporate thermal management systems to prevent overheating in enclosed conditions.
Application Areas
These rugged electrical enclosures find widespread use across numerous industrial sectors. Construction sites utilize them for temporary power distribution that withstands weather exposure and job site hazards. Manufacturing plants install them in washdown areas where equipment cleaning is routine. Marine and offshore applications demand waterproof socket boxes for dockside power and vessel service connections. Other key applications include wastewater treatment facilities, food processing plants, mining operations, and outdoor entertainment venues. Their versatility makes them equally valuable for permanent installations and temporary power needs.
Maintenance and Precautions
Proper maintenance ensures long-term reliability of waterproof socket boxes. Regular inspections should verify seal integrity, check for corrosion, and confirm all fasteners remain tight. Gaskets typically require replacement every 1-3 years depending on environmental exposure. Critical precautions include never operating with damaged seals, avoiding exposure beyond the rated IP classification, and ensuring proper cable gland selection for complete ingress protection. Users should always de-energize the unit before servicing and follow lockout/tagout procedures. Overloading circuits can generate heat that compromises seal effectiveness over time.
B2B Procurement Guide
When sourcing industrial waterproof socket boxes, professionals should first assess environmental requirements including potential chemical exposure, temperature extremes, and physical impact risks. Verify necessary certifications for your region and industry (e.g., ATEX for hazardous areas). Consider future expansion needs by selecting modular designs that allow socket additions. Evaluate mounting options (wall, pole, or freestanding) and cable entry locations. For large orders, request samples to test seal performance under your specific conditions. Leading manufacturers typically offer customization services for specialized applications requiring unique configurations or materials.
